A recent TikTok clip from a creator documenting a GLP-1 journey adds a new variable: Tesamorelin. In the video, the creator describes feeling “a new gear in the gym” after just one week, attributing increased energy during lifts to the peptide. The caption implies that while a GLP-1 handled appetite, Tesamorelin is “handling the output.” The tone is measured—explicitly “not chasing hype”—but the claim is clear: Tesamorelin can rapidly enhance physical energy and performance.
What the research neighborhood actually covers
Tesamorelin is a synthetic growth hormone-releasing hormone (GHRH) analog. Its primary studied role is to stimulate the pituitary to release endogenous growth hormone (GH). Most clinical research has focused on its ability to reduce visceral adipose tissue in HIV-associated lipodystrophy, where it has shown modest benefits over 6–12 months. The peptide is also being explored for other metabolic and body-composition outcomes, but these are early-stage or off-label.
Growth hormone does influence metabolism and energy substrate availability, but the effects are not immediate. GH release is pulsatile, and changes in body composition or exercise capacity typically require weeks to months of consistent use. There is no published, peer-reviewed evidence that Tesamorelin produces a noticeable increase in training energy within seven days. The research neighborhood is about chronic metabolic regulation, not acute ergogenic boosts.
Limits, missing context, and what a 15-second clip cannot show
The clip is a self-report, uncontrolled, and confounded. The creator is also using a GLP-1 (likely semaglutide or tirzepatide), which can independently affect energy, food intake, and perceived well-being. The “new gear” could stem from improved sleep, diet, hydration, or simply the placebo effect—especially when starting a new injectable. A single week is too short to attribute any change to Tesamorelin’s pharmacological action, which requires accumulation of GH and downstream IGF-1.
Moreover, the clip does not disclose dosage, frequency, or whether Tesamorelin is used alone or stacked. It also omits potential side effects, such as injection-site reactions, fluid retention, or joint pain. The creator’s anecdote is not data, and the absence of a control period makes it impossible to isolate the peptide’s contribution.
How this maps to named research compounds
Tesamorelin is a distinct GHRH analog, different from GHRP-6, Hexarelin, or Ipamorelin, which act on ghrelin receptors. In research settings, Tesamorelin is often compared to CJC-1295 (with or without DAC) for its GH-stimulating profile. However, the clip does not mention any other catalog compound, so the focus remains on Tesamorelin alone. For researchers, Tesamorelin’s value lies in its ability to selectively increase GH pulse amplitude, which may have implications for metabolic studies—not as a pre-workout.

Can Tesamorelin increase energy within one week?
There is no published evidence to support a rapid energy boost. Tesamorelin's effects on growth hormone secretion are gradual and typically measured over months.
What is Tesamorelin primarily studied for?
Tesamorelin is primarily studied for reducing visceral fat in HIV-associated lipodystrophy and for its potential metabolic benefits.
How does Tesamorelin differ from GLP-1 medications?
Tesamorelin stimulates growth hormone release, while GLP-1 medications target appetite and insulin secretion. They act on different pathways.
